Transaction 515722ae7145183c108b60f6738c5197c43b5b06510e69d6d4e4c83d999826af

1 Input
2 Outputs
  • 515722ae7145183c108b60f6738c5197c43b5b06510e69d6d4e4c83d999826af:0
  • value  3944
    address  13AQ7VDmtLnWQezeLGDj673UBMXznUYgLw
  • 515722ae7145183c108b60f6738c5197c43b5b06510e69d6d4e4c83d999826af:1
  • value  6481
    address  34V1DwKQpqK7Roxcf3pENq9mmzVF97iKqZ